    Smart Hospitals Market size was valued at USD 420.59 Billion in 2024 and is poised to grow from USD 451.84 Billion in 2025 to USD 801.66 Bill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 7.43% during the forecast period (2026–2033).

    One key driver behind the growth of the global smart hospitals market is the increasing adoption of advanced healthcare technologies. The integration of Internet of Things (IoT) solutions, Artificial Intelligence (AI), big data analytics, and machine learning in healthcare facilities enables efficient operations, cost reduction, and improved patient outcomes. These technologies provide real-time monitoring, predictive analytics, and automation of routine tasks, empowering healthcare providers to deliver personalized, high-quality care. The demand for these advanced technologies and their potential to revolutionize healthcare processes drives the expansion of the smart hospitals market.

    A key market trend in the global smart hospitals market is the increasing focus on telehealth and remote patient monitoring. The growing demand for accessible and convenient healthcare services has led to the adoption of telemedicine solutions and remote monitoring technologies. Smart hospitals are leveraging telehealth platforms to provide virtual consultations, remote diagnosis, and monitoring of patients in real-time. This trend is driven by factors such as technological advancements, the need for personalized healthcare, and the ability to overcome geographical barriers, resulting in improved healthcare access and patient outcomes.

    North America emerges as the dominating region in the global smart hospitals market. It holds a significant market share due to its advanced healthcare infrastructure and high adoption rates of new technologies. The United States, in particular, stands out with its well-developed healthcare system and substantial investments in smart hospitals. The region's strong emphasis on technological innovation, coupled with a favorable regulatory environment, has propelled the growth of smart hospitals in North America. The presence of major healthcare technology companies and collaborations between healthcare providers and technology firms further contribute to the region's dominance. North America is witnessing an increasing integration of IoT solutions, AI-powered systems, and big data analytics into healthcare facilities, enabling streamlined processes, improved patient outcomes, and cost reduction.
